hi guys, i got an issue here and i hope you guys could help. since i upgraded to win 10 and the vPilot actually work fine with my P3D and after around half month, the vPilot are not working anymore. i did try to troubleshoot, reinstall and tried other method that i can do with it but still not able to get it right. when i click the application even run in administrator, it come out nothing. few moment after and it appear a window:
Error Loading Config
The following error occurred while attempting to load configuration object:
Timed out waiting for a program to executed. The command being executed was "C:\Windows\Microsoft.NET\Framework\v2.0.52727\csc.exe" /noconfig/fullpaths @"C:\Users\Jackson\AppData\Local\Temp\ufrf0lfh.cmdline".
when i use the troubleshooting in control panel and test program, the column under the issues found was Incompatible Program, is it the vPilot itself not compatible for win 10 or something in my win 10 missing?

Jackson, another user has had success fixing this issue by running vPilot in compatibility mode. He selected Windows 7 in the compatibility mode dropdown and also runs vPilot as an administrator. _________________ Ross Carlson - Developer
